How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rosemont?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Rosemont Studio Apartments | $2,819 | $1,595 | $7,156 |
Rosemont 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,951 | $1,805 | $9,809 |
Rosemont 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,023 | $1,975 | $10,000+ |
Rosemont 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,898 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|
Rosemont 4 Bedroom Apartments | $8,310 | $8,310 | $8,310 |
